CC -!- FUNCTION: Regulatory subunit of the calcium activated potassium
CC KCNMA1 (maxiK) channel. Modulates the calcium sensitivity and
CC gating kinetics of KCNMA1, thereby contributing to KCNMA1 channel
CC diversity. Increases the apparent Ca(2+)/voltage sensitivity of
CC the KCNMA1 channel. It also modifies KCNMA1 channel kinetics and
CC alters its pharmacological properties. It slows down the
CC activation and the deactivation kinetics of the channel. Acts as a
CC negative regulator of smooth muscle contraction by enhancing the
CC calcium sensitivity to KCNMA1. Its presence is also a requirement
CC for internal binding of the KCNMA1 channel opener
CC dehydrosoyasaponin I (DHS-1) triterpene glycoside and for external
CC binding of the agonist hormone 17-beta-estradiol (E2). Increases
CC the binding activity of charybdotoxin (CTX) toxin to KCNMA1
CC peptide blocker by increasing the CTX association rate and
CC decreasing the dissociation rate.
CC -!- SUBUNIT: Interacts with KCNMA1 tetramer. There are probably 4
CC molecules of KCMNB1 per KCNMA1 tetramer.

CC -!- TISSUE SPECIFICITY: Abundantly expressed in smooth muscle. Low
CC levels of expression in most other tissues. Within the brain,
CC relatively high levels found in hippocampus and corpus callosum.
CC -!- PTM: N-glycosylated.
CC -!- POLYMORPHISM: Genetic variation in KCNMB1 can influence the
CC severity of diastolic hypertension.
